
The ARF465AG is a N-Channel Enhancement Mode MOSFET with a continuous drain current of 6A and a gate to source voltage of 30V. It has a maximum operating temperature of 150°C and a minimum operating temperature of -55°C. The device is mounted through a hole and is compliant with RoHS regulations. The MOSFET has a fall time of 12ns and a turn-off delay time of 21ns, with a turn-on delay time of 7ns.
